A dataset from SCIOPS evaluates age estimation methods for Patagonian and Antarctic toothfish using lead-radium dating. The study compares methodologies from the Center for Quantitative Fisheries Science in the USA and the Central Ageing Facility in Australia. Findings indicate age estimation accuracy for fish up to approximately 50 years and validate growth zone periodicity.
2001 to 2003 acoustic data was recorded west of the Antarctic Peninsula by 7 instruments as part of the Southern Ocean GLOBEC program. The dataset contains low-frequency (10-250 Hz) continuous samples, with a maximum volume of approximately 28 GB per instrument. It was collected by the SCIOPS organization and is situated within the Palmer Long-Term Ecological Research grid.
331 paired stations on Georges Bank during 1996 and 1997 were used to compare the 0.61-m Bongo and 1-m2 MOCNESS samplers. Catches of larvae from the MOCNESS were 3 to 5 times greater than those from the Bongo, with significant differences found for 14 of 22 dominant taxa. Meteorological and sea surface parameters were also recorded during 67 US GLOBEC cruises to the region from 1995-1999.
35 significant habitat complexes for key species in the New York Bight watershed, mapped as separate GIS layers. NOAA_NCEI compiled this data from 1971 to 1996, covering eastern New Jersey, the Hudson River to Troy, and southern Long Island. The data were designed for use at a scale of 1:100,000.
Fisheries and Oceans Canada's Coastal Environmental Baseline Program collected ecological information on the current state of key coastal ecosystems. The data includes physical, chemical, and biological baseline measurements from projects undertaken from 2018 to 2022 at six coastal sites across Canada. It supports evidence-based assessments and management decisions for preserving marine ecosystems.
BLM Idaho Range Improvement Poly is a geodatabase consolidating locations of rangeland structures on Bureau of Land Management land in Idaho. The dataset includes polygon features for structures like water troughs, fences, and reservoirs, with data migrated from historic paper systems and the automated Range Improvement Project System (RIPS). It is a work in progress, lacking data from the Coeur d'Alene and Cottonwood field offices and containing potentially incomplete attributes.

ANATOBIRD is a morphology-informed computational modeling framework for simulating the optical response of iridescent feather structures. The model integrates microstructural geometry, including barbule inclination, with nanoscale multilayer architecture composed of melanin, keratin, and air layers. Parks Canada provides an annual composite measure of invasive species presence in Prince Edward Island National Park forest ecosystems. The dataset includes two annual field measurements: the percentage of forest ecosystem with invasive species present (measured across 244, 441 m2 quadrats) and the percentage of total forest area in hectares with invasive species present. It tracks four invasive plants and one insect.
Parks Canada staff collect exuviae from dragonflies and damselflies in four shallow water ponds twice per year during peak emergence periods. The objective is to acquire baseline data on species diversity and relative abundance within park wetlands. Taxonomic diversity and abundance are compared against historical levels to assess ecological integrity.

Oregon State University collected this lichen monitoring data for the National Park Service during the summer of 2012. The field work was conducted in Gates of the Arctic National Park and Preserve, following a specific terrestrial vegetation monitoring protocol for Arctic Alaska. The data is associated with CESU agreement # H8W07060001.
